# Stormfan — weather-alert fan-out worker
# Consumes alerts from the Cloudpeal feed, fans out to push, SMS,
# and webhook channels. One worker per region; do not run two
# against the same queue or subscribers get duplicates.
# Retry policy lives in retry.toml, not here. Keep channel
# toggles above the credentials section. Rotate secrets quarterly.
# The fan-out broker requires an auth credential; set it on the
# next line:

env line for fafof-fahag: LEDGER_TOKEN5=f8790

## Runbook: Incremental Rebuilds (Lampkin Static Pipeline)

When a content edit lands, the Lampkin builder rebuilds only affected pages using the dependency graph stored in the build-state database. If rebuilds stall, clear the stale lock rows and re-trigger. The build-state database is accessed with the connection string below.

replica DSN, fahif-bagag: cockroachdb://casok_svc:V7@db-3280.zemvarsoft.example:5432/briion

Handover note — Crumbwheel order cutoffs.

Welcome aboard. The bakery cutoff rule in Crumbwheel closes same-day orders at 14:00 local to each storefront, not UTC — this has bitten us twice. Holiday overrides live in the calendar service and take precedence silently, so always check there first when a cutoff looks wrong. To unlock the calendar service's admin console after a restart, enter the recovery passphrase below.

vault phrase of bagap-bahaf = silion-pelox-sorox-casdor-quenwyn-fraax-eliox-praael-kelion-quenvan-kasox-rusael-norius-belvan

This alert indicates the Polyglotta string-extraction script failed during the nightly run, so new translation keys were not pushed to the localization queue. Untranslated strings may ship in the next Weaverly release if unresolved. The failure is usually a malformed template literal. Triage steps are on the internal page below.

operations page: https://vault.qorvelcorp.example/settings